Preview
Seattle is back in Chase Field for game two of their three-game road trip to Arizona. They took game one last night by a close 6-5 scoreline to take a 1-0 series lead. The Mariners are now on a three-game winning streak and are coming off of the back of a 2-1 series win at home to the Astros, where they shut out baseball's second-best scoring team in 2021 - the Astros - in their back to back wins. The Diamondbacks season is almost all but over. With no hope of making the playoffs, Arizona is simply playing out the remainder of their season awaiting the official elimination. They did beat the Padres in the final game of their last series to snap a five-game losing streak but still lost that series 2-1 after losing 3-1 to the Phillies.
Pitching matchup
Mariners
Marco Gonzales (6-5, 4.03 ERA) Left-handed pitcher Marco Gonzales will start his 20th game of the season for the Mariners. Gonzales is a career 4.08 pitcher in his seven seasons in the majors. His 2014 rookie-season ERA was 4.15 and his season-best came in 2020 when he had a 3.10 ERA. Gonzales has 107.1 innings under his belt this year and has gone for 48 ERs off 99 hits while striking out 83 batters and walking 32.
Diamondbacks
Humberto Castellanos (1-1, 2.14 ERA) Humberto Castellanos starts on the mound for the D'backs. He's a second-year pitcher with a 1.14 WHIP and an impressive 2.14 ERA in nine games and two starts. He had a 6.75 ERA in 2020 over eight games with the Astros. Castellanos only played once in August pitching for 5.1 innings and with only a single ER from three hits to go along with one strikeout and two walks.
